Anyone ordering maintenance post May 1st using FTPs to download? Here was the
announcement:
As of May 1, 2021, to download files from IBM's secure delivery server using
FTPS, it is necessary to enable TLS 1.2 in the z/OS Communications Server FTP
client program.
So, we've enabled ATTLS via
I should have commented that the HTTPS method is working fine. And my last
successful FTPs download was last week Monday April 26th.
